Corpus Christi Turns to Drilling as Water Runs Low

By 2030, this stretch of coast will face a water shortfall of nearly 28 million gallons per day if alternate supplies are not developed

The coastal city also has been trying for years to develop a seawater desalination plant, but its efforts have lagged as big, thirsty industries continue to locate nearby and a five-year drought persists.

Fixing a Perforated Casing with Cement

If you have perforated casing and the formation no longer produces enough, you must seal the open perforation with cement before you drill down to the next aquifer.
